Nice writing by Jennifer Young from TLB in her Tour Diary articles:

Fear Not

It’s late Wednesday night, we just landed in San Jose, CA after our two week east coast tour leg with UFO and we’re driving home. A three hour drive after an all day flight really bites. But then again the $600 fare difference for flying out of San Luis Obispo also bites.

As we race through the dark, the jet lag setting in, I feel like I’ll be turning into a pumpkin any minute. We’re all weary and I’m overwhelmingly tired of lunchmeat sandwiches and iceburg lettuce.

I’m very proud of our little band. We always work hard, play hard, and at the end of it all, sleep hard. But the last two weeks we’ve pushed our selves to new levels of “hard”.

If it can be summed up at all, it would be the moment I was standing on the B.B. King stage, downtown Manhattan on 42nd street, electrified by the adrenaline coursing through my veins after having navigated through perhaps the worst driving city in the world, Vinnie Moore behind me peeking from the backstage curtains, then looking over and seeing Travis wailing away on a perfectly choreographed version of Burn Season. I thought several things: “What the hell am I doing here?” “This is tough.” “This is awesome.” “No Fear.”

Fear is such a normal part of our society that we don’t even realize the extent that it is pushed on us. Every thing we see or hear is laced with a form of fear, from food labels to swine flu to terrorists. It is a warm blanket that keeps the herd controlled, manageable and peacefully grazing on their soylent green. A man scared for his life will trust his instincts and live, a society scared will shrivel and die.

Fear not your life. Crawl out from under that warm blanket and go do something uncomfortable, something that'll make you sweat a little.

“….seek the achievement of happiness….exist for the sake of earning rewards. Threats will not make us function; fear is not our incentive. It is not death that we wish to avoid, but life that we wish to live.”

Guess you had to be there....

By J Young (Jan. 10)
